Data-Admin-Requestor instance "sdev718!BATCH" not found in 5.2 to 7.1.8 upgrade
We were performing the upgrade assessment for one of our customer from PRPC 5.2 to PRPC 7.1 ML8. The upgrade went successful and post upgrade after deploying the war/ear files the PRPC engine didn’t come up providing the following exception as it is referring to requestor type "sdev718!BATCH". Caused by: com.pega.pegarules.pub.context.InvalidConfigurationException: Data-Admin-Requestor instance "sdev718!BATCH" not found
**Moderation Team has archived post**
This post has been archived for educational purposes. Contents and links will no longer be updated. If you have the same/similar question, please write a new post.
Customers upgrading from PRPC 6.1 SP2 and earlier versions to 7.1 ML8 would envounter this issue. While upgrading an auto-generated prconfig.xml is used with setting source set to ‘file’ which ignores the DASS values. And while bringing up the system post-upgrade, the system tries to use the setting from DASS.
We have overcome this issue by adding the following code in proconfig.xml and restarted the instance after which the PRPC engine was started properly.
Hi ,I too got the below error when i did an upgrade from 55sp1 to 718
Caught exception while retrieving Data-Admin-Requestor instance "pega!BATCH".I changed the system name in prconfig and redeployed the ear and still facing the issue.Above solution is not working.
After making the temp fix to switch the system name to PRPC in prconfig file, I believe one has to reconfigure the system name to the oringinal instance. For example, in the scenario posted in the question, the system name has to re-configured to 'sdev718' post-upgrade.